WebThe first three years of a child’s life are one of the most critical phases of brain development. In these early years, infants’ brains are developing more than one million neural connections every second. Parents and caregivers play a key role in creating the foundation for a young child’s social and emotional development. http://www.urbanchildinstitute.org/why-0-3/baby-and-brain WebJan 16, 2024 · Early intervention: Is the term used to describe services and support that help babies and toddlers (from birth to 3 years of age in most states/territories) with developmental delays or disabilities and their families. May include speech therapy, physical therapy, and other types of services based on the needs of the child and family.

The Montessori Educational Method is … WebThe most intensive period of speech and language development for humans is during the first three years of life, a period when the brain is developing and maturing. These skills appear to develop best in a world that is rich with sounds, sights, and consistent exposure to the speech and language of others.
